  • unless your bank chooses to cover your mistake, temporarily, it will refuse to pay the check, and will charge you a fee for overdrawing your account, and return the check to your landlord's bank. your landlord's bank will charge HIM a fee for sending them a check that bounced and I imagine he will want you to reimburse him in the future and pay with a cashier's check in the future. take a personal finance class. if you don't have enough money in your account to cover ever single check you've written, all on the same day, the money wasn't "in there"
  • Contact your landlord immediately, explain to him/her what happened, apologize and hope that an arrangement for payment can be worked out, including bank charges he will face and even some interest. Don't do it again!
